When I started this blog I just wanted to talk about my love of cheese and travel. I have since found one of the fabulous side benefits is that as a “food blogger” I also have the opportunity to sample some of the best food in town.

Last night I was invited to a private tasting of the new summer menu Gordon Ramsay Five Star Restaurant at St Regis Doha. I am a regular at the sister restaurant Opal, but haven’t had an opportunity to try the fine dining option. When the call came, I didn’t hesitate.

Before we even got to the main event, the amuse bouche – a take on a caprese salad with an emulsion of white cheese, basil sorbet and tomato sucked me in. There is no “after” photo of this because I basically devoured it in one bite. It literally was summer in a bite – fresh, clean and a little surprising.

During June Gordon Ramsay Five Star will be offering this menu of “plates” rather than it’s full menu. July in Doha is Ramadan, the Holy Month, when the restaurants close during the day and the focus is on evenings and more traditional Arabic fare. This menu will take the restaurant into the holiday period and give diners a taste of one of a handful of fine dining venues in Doha.
